Mystery Doug takes on a real kid's question -- "What's the coldest temperature any animal could survive?" -- and follows the clues. A few amazing animals, like wood frogs and tardigrades, can survive being frozen and then thaw back to life. A quick five-minute watch to spark curiosity and kick off a conversation.
